Rain Stops Play will feature new hilarious stories from the
commentary box of Test Match Special one of the nations favourite
institutions. Each date will feature a line up of cricketing legends
from Jonathan Agnew, Mike Gatting, Neil Foster, David Graveney,
Graham Gooch and Geoff Miller, hosted by Ralph Dellor.
2007's show will feature all new hilarious stories and an inside
review of the Ashes series 2006/7 and a preview of the 2007 Cricket
World Cup.
Rain Stops Play will give cricket lovers of all ages the opportunity
to hear about the stories, triumphs and tears all live on stage.
There will also be a chance to pose your own cricketing questions to
the cast and expand the waistlines of TMS commentators by bringing
cakes to the stage door
